Playing a ULAW (.au) stream (either via /dev/audio or /dev/dsp) frequently
now repeats the first chunk in the stream.  That is, you'll hear the full
stream, and then a half second or so off the front of that stream.

Might may be related to the hang-on-close() fix.

It's easy to reproduce.  Most of the .au's I have lying around do this now.
I've uploaded 3 of them to rah as:

     TSTSND-att.au
     TSTSND-autopil.au
     TSTSND-elvis-has-left-bldg.au

Just "cat snd.au > /dev/audio".
